SEAA 6-stage Men’s Relays

A late flurry of interest, helped along by Andrew Taylor's enthusiasm, meant that we sent three teams to Aldershot on Sunday to contest the Southern 6-stage road relays. 62 full teams competed, along with a number of incomplete teams and the standard was very high. Despite running a minute faster than in 2009 our A team finished 3 places lower – in 16th – but still more than good enough to qualify for the national road relays in October.
Our B team finished 31st – a similar result to a year ago. To put this in perpective, this is a better result than our A team was achieving five or six years ago. The C team finished 59th, beating the result of our B team's from a few years ago.
Aldershot, Farnham & District AC won, 8 minutes ahead of our A team, although they did have Ben Moreau on the team!
